WSO2 API Platform: Monetize Your APIs With Stripe

See how to set up API monetization in WSO2 API Platform, from connecting Stripe to letting consumers subscribe and pay for API access. This demo walks through the full monetization flow in WSO2 API Platform. You'll start by connecting Stripe as your payment provider, adding your secret key and publishable key from the Stripe dashboard. From there, you'll create a subscription plan, set a rate limit, and choose a pricing model. WSO2 API Platform supports five pricing models: free, flat rate, per unit, volume, and graduated tier. This walkthrough sets up a flat rate plan billed monthly at $12.

Extracting and Harvesting Metadata for Cloudera Data Lineage

This is a comprehensive walkthrough of the metadata extraction process for Cloudera Data Lineage. Learn how to utilize the harvesting agent to set up a new metadata source, such as Informatica Oracle, and perform a local extraction. The video demonstrates how the agent securely reads metadata from databases, ETL tools, and reporting systems, staging it as local XML files to ensure data does not leave the network without explicit action.
